Guide to Buying Crushed Stone and Gravel

Some specialty crushed stone sizes to know: #57 – This size contains stones between 1/2 and 1 1/2 inches. #67 – Ranging from 3/4 inch to smaller. #410 – Comprised of #4 crushed stone and stone dust. Crushed Stone and Gravel Sizes: Chart and Grades Explained

Unlike Crushed Stones #57, it has rock screenings or rock dust created during breaking and crushing rock when making Crushed Stones #411. Crushed Stone

Rock Types Used for Crushed Stone. Many different rock types are used to make crushed stone. The types used to make crushed stone in the United States during 2020 include the following: limestone, granite, trap rock, sandstone, quartzite, dolomite, marble, volcanic cinder and scoria, slate, shell, and calcareous marl [1]. Home

Spicewood Crushed Stone, LLC, operates a rock quarry located on Texas State Highway 71 in Spicewood, Texas. Spicewood Crushed Stone mines high quality limestone and dolomite from the Honeycut Formation of the Ellenberger Group.
